The German second-tier outfit are set to swoop for the services of the stopper of Ghanaian descent in the upcoming winter transfer window
German 2.Bundesliga side FC Köln have Swiss-born Ghanaian defender Gregory Wuthrich on their shortlist in an effort to land him from Austrian Bundesliga outfit SK Sturm Graz.
The 30-year-old defender, who came close to joining German top-flight side FC Augsburg during the summer, could now team-up with the lower division side as he figures on top of their shopping list ahead of the January transfer window.
According to a report filed by Cologne-based newspaper Kölnische Rundschau, the former top-flight campaigners are eager to bolster their back line options with the acquisition of the Ghanaian centre-back as a replacement for injured defender Luca Kilian.
Given his remarkable outings in the Austrian Bundesliga contests, his current suitors are to fork out an amount of 4 million euros if they are to prise him away in this upcoming winter transfer window as per his transfermarkt valuation.
Wuthrich remains unfit to represent Ghana on the international stage as he's been cap-tied twice by the Switzerland men's senior national team.
